With its huge glazed area which stretches beyond the full width of the roof, the optional electric panoramic tilting/sliding roof is a striking feature in itself. Not just bathing the interior with light, it offers a clear view of the sky above, and when opened lets the sunshine and fresh air in. You choose how much of this you want: the roof can be adjusted or fully opened, and when the sun is shining strong, the tinted glass and high-quality roller blind ensure that the interior remains at a comfortable temperature.
The Digital Cockpit instrument cluster displays classic gauges such as speedometer and odometer as standard1 on a high-resolution 20.32 cm (8”) colour display. On the Digital Cockpit Pro2, the image in the 26.04 cm (10.25”) display can be customised according to individual preferences. For example then, you can choose how to visualise your driver assistance systems or combine navigation map and media display – all with appealing graphics and animations.

The Beats by Dr Dre earphones brand is world renowned. Now, from the same sound specialist, comes the BeatsAudio™ sound system, available as an option for the Polo in the Life equipment line and higher. Six harmonised speakers supply perfect sound to each seat, with the additional subwoofer delivering ultra-deep bass. All boxes are boosted by a 300 watt 8-channel amplifier.

The Polo includes a capacitive steering wheel when you opt for a TSI engine which has Travel Assist as standard: thanks to the steering wheels touch-sensitive surface, it can detect whether you physically have your hands on the wheel. Travel Assist puts the comfort into driving by providing assistance in monotonous and tiring situations. Travel Assist also helps keep you in lane and maintain your speed while taking into account the distance from vehicles in front, especially on motorways and major roads.
Alongside the conventional airbags, the central airbag in the Polooffers protection against a collision between driver and passenger.1 In addition, there are two curtain airbags on board, which in an emergency deploy from the headliner like curtains, covering the entire side window areas from front to back, including the B-pillar. This provides effective protection for everyone in the car, including those in the rear seats.1
Optional adaptive cruise control (ACC)1 can help you keep within your pre-set maximum speed (up to 130mph/210 km/h)3 and maintain your distance to the vehicle in front.2 It also helps your Polo to automatically stop and start moving in traffic jams (if the DSG automatic gearbox option is installed).
Predictive cruise control and cornering assist is added to the ACC in combination with the navigation system4. This helps you avoid exceeding the speed limits by identifying the official limits along the route.2 The system also uses route data from the navigation system to adapt the vehicle’s own speed to corners, junctions (exits), and roundabouts.2

The Side Assist lane change assist system uses an LED lamp in the exterior mirrors to indicate that there are other vehicles in the blind spot or driving up to 70 m behind you.1 When you indicate to change lanes, the system calculates whether one of these vehicles could pose a hazard based on position and speed, and then flashes to alert you to this.

The Polo with optional Park Assist1 including parking distance warning system not only tells you whether a parking space is large enough when driving past, but can also drive into it for you2. You control the clutch, accelerator, and brake, and observe your surroundings,2 and the system does the rest.
Sensors scan suitable parking spaces (up to a maximum of 40 km/h).
Parallel parking spaces must have one vehicle length plus 80 cm manoeuvring distance for parking, and at least 25 cm in front of and behind the vehicle for driving out of a parking space.
Parking bays must have at least 35 cm clearance on both sides.
